Farah Khan Jokes Aamir Khan Cut Vir Das’ Delhi Belly Song Out of Jealousy

Farah Khan and Vir Das recently sat down for a laughter-filled conversation that quickly turned into a nostalgic—and slightly mischievous—trip down Bollywood memory lane. What started as casual banter soon led to a playful behind-the-scenes revelation involving Aamir Khan, Vir Das, and the cult classic Delhi Belly.

A fun reunion ahead of a new film

The timing couldn’t have been better. Aamir Khan’s production house has just announced Happy Patel: Khatarnak Jasoos, a quirky spy comedy that also marks Vir Das’ directorial debut. Slated for a theatrical release on January 16, 2026, the film was unveiled with a tongue-in-cheek announcement video featuring Aamir and Vir poking fun at each other.

The caption promised a wild mix of comedy, action, romance, and “some spy stuff as well,” setting the tone for a very self-aware entertainer. The film also stars Mona Singh, adding to the curiosity around the project.

Fun with Farah and old memories

Ahead of the film’s release, Vir appeared on Fun With Farah, shot at his home, where Farah Khan did what she does best—mix humour with brutally honest nostalgia. The duo spoke about Vir’s career highs and lows before drifting back to Delhi Belly, the irreverent comedy that cemented Vir’s pop-culture presence thanks to the unforgettable song Jaa Chudail.

Vir shared that Happy Patel draws inspiration from Farah’s signature style of big, spoofy humour seen in films like Tees Maar Khan. In fact, he confidently said that anyone who enjoys Om Shanti Om will likely vibe with his new movie as well.

The Andaz Apna Apna surprise

The conversation took an unexpected turn when Farah casually mentioned that she always believed Andaz Apna Apna would flop when it first released—and technically, it did at the box office back then. Vir looked genuinely shocked, joking that Aamir had never revealed this “small detail” to him. The moment perfectly captured how Bollywood’s biggest cult classics often have the strangest release histories.

“Aamir cut it out of jealousy”

But the real highlight came when Farah dropped her cheekiest claim yet. Recalling Jaa Chudail, she reminded everyone that she had choreographed the song and even roped in Vir’s wife, Shivani, who fondly remembered the shoot as pure chaos and fun.

Farah then jokingly claimed that Vir’s song was trimmed because Aamir’s own number followed next. “He cut it out of jealousy,” she laughed, clearly in a playful mood. Vir, staying in character, mock-defended the official version, saying he was told the edit happened due to “pacing issues.”

Whether it was jealousy or just smart editing, the anecdote added another layer of charm to Delhi Belly’s already legendary behind-the-scenes stories.
